		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>spmat, jake-the-goose, and the rest of you Jindal supporters &#8211; I understand.  I used to be one of you.  I voted for Jindal every chance I got.  Every campaign I had a yard sign, I volunteered in the phone bank, and participated in get out the vote efforts.  And <a href="http://www.bayoubuzz.com/News/Louisiana/Government/Louisiana_Legislature_Pay_Raises_Budget_Lunacy__3947.asp" rel="nofollow">here&#8217;s what I got</a> for my troubles.  In spite of the fact that&#8217;s he&#8217;s enjoyed overwhelming support AND has a line item veto, Louisiana is going to be a good deal worse off when Jindal leaves office.  He is about as conservative as our Congressional GOP, which is to say, hardly at all:</p>
<blockquote><p>A budget is being proposed that will increase spending to $29.7 billion, <strong>tripling the size of government in only 12 years</strong>, giving Louisiana the highest growth of government per capita in the South. The budget also adds another 1,000 employees to state government. [so much for Jindal's "hiring freeze" - as toothless as his ethics reform!] Per capita, Louisiana has more state and local employees than any other Southern state. According to recent data from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, there are approximately 350,000 individuals employed in state and local government in Louisiana. Among that total, about 110,000 are state employees. <strong>While we grow government and add more people to the state payroll, nothing is being done to improve the private sector</strong>, which is contracting in Louisiana. There are no proposals being debated in the legislature to give substantial tax cuts to Louisiana businesses, even though they are overtaxed and being constantly courted to leave the state.</p>
<p>&#8230; <strong>We are moving quickly down the road toward socialism in Louisiana, as our tax rates are high, our government is large and our private sector is small and continually hamstrung with high taxes, needless regulations and overbearing government interference.</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>That&#8217;s Jindal&#8217;s record.  Although he has massive support and a line item veto, instead of applying those conservative principles he campaigned on, he&#8217;s driving us further left.  He&#8217;s rapidly becoming more popular with Democrats than with Republicans &#8211; much like John McCain.  Jindal played us, and now we&#8217;re stuck with him, but there&#8217;s no reason the rest of the country can&#8217;t wise up and learn from our mistake.</p>
